Planting Calendar for Lisianthus

Frost tolerance for lisianthus: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After the last frost.

You can not plant lisianthus until after all chance of frost has passed because they are not cold tolerant.

The earliest that you can plant lisianthus in Chula Vista is February. However, you really should wait until March if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ant lisianthus and expect a good harvest is probably September. If you wait any later than that and your lisianthus may not have a chance to really do well. If you are starting your lisianthus ind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a couple of weeks earlier.

Last Frost Date

In Chula Vista the average date of last frost happens on January 31. In the coldest months of winter you should expect an average low temperature of 35°F.

Always keep in mind that USDA zone info for Chula Vista is just an average and the actual date of last frost can change quite a bit from year to year. Half of the time in Chula Vista you get a frost after January 31 so always be ready to cover your lisianthus if you have a surprise late frost.
